The Waiting Station is the first and last thing every employee sees. Located at the facility's single accessible entrance, it serves as the orientation center for all new hires. The recruitment process is efficient: employees arrive, receive their uniforms and quota assignments, and begin their first shift immediately.
The station features a series of motivational posters displayed behind glass cases. Messages include "Productivity Is Freedom," "Auntie Loves a Hard Worker," and "Silence Is Safety." The posters have not been updated since 1962.
A PA system broadcasts continuous messages from Auntie_OS, interspersed with elevator music that has been described as "uncomfortably cheerful." The volume cannot be adjusted. The speakers cannot be located.

The most notable feature of the Waiting Station is its door. The entrance to the production floor is a reinforced blast door that opens automatically when an employee approaches. It does not open from the other side.
Exit from the facility is only possible through the Sanitation Station's decontamination process, which requires clearance from a compliance officer. The average processing time for exit clearance is 47 days.
